Davido Reveals Eight-Year Cohabitation Before Marriage to Chioma

Nigerian Afrobeats star, David Adeleke, known as Davido, has disclosed that he and his wife, Chioma Rowland, shared a home for eight years prior to their formal marriage.

In an interview on The Bootleg Kev Podcast, Davido recounted meeting Chioma during his university years, attributing the ease of their marital transition to their extensive period of living together.

“My wife and I had already established a life together well before our wedding,” Davido stated. “We met during my college days, and fortunately, we moved in together relatively early on—about eight years before we officially tied the knot.”

While acknowledging the familiarity of their shared history, Davido also recognized the unique challenges that come with marriage. “The shift was smooth, but marriage is a different ball game entirely,” he remarked.

He further highlighted Chioma’s steadfast support throughout their relationship, particularly her understanding of the demands of his career.

“Throughout our time living together, I was constantly touring and on the road,” Davido explained. “She always understood the nature of my work and recognized that I thrive when I’m working. She knows my passion for music, just as she loves being in the kitchen.”
